In recent years, the field of environmental monitoring has seen significant advancements due to the development of various technologies. One such technology that has gained prominence is the airborne remote sensing technique. This technique utilizes aircraft or drones equipped with sensors to collect data about the Earth's surface from the air. The ability to gather information from a distance provides numerous advantages over traditional ground-based methods, making it an invaluable tool for researchers and environmentalists alike.The airborne remote sensing technique can capture a wide range of data, including temperature, humidity, vegetation cover, and land use patterns. By analyzing this data, scientists can monitor changes in the environment, assess natural resources, and even predict natural disasters. For instance, during wildfires, these sensors can provide real-time information about fire spread, helping firefighters make informed decisions about containment strategies.One of the most significant benefits of using the airborne remote sensing technique is its ability to cover large areas quickly and efficiently. Traditional surveying methods can be time-consuming and labor-intensive, often requiring teams of people to traverse difficult terrain. In contrast, airborne sensors can cover vast landscapes in a fraction of the time, allowing for more comprehensive data collection.Moreover, the resolution of the data obtained through the airborne remote sensing technique is often superior to that of satellite imagery. This high-resolution data is crucial for applications such as urban planning, where detailed information about land use and infrastructure is necessary. By providing precise measurements, this technique enables city planners to make better-informed decisions that can lead to more sustainable development practices.Another area where the airborne remote sensing technique excels is in agricultural monitoring. Farmers can utilize this technology to assess crop health, optimize irrigation, and manage resources more effectively. For example, multispectral sensors can detect variations in plant health by measuring light reflectance at different wavelengths. This information allows farmers to identify areas that may require additional nutrients or water, ultimately improving crop yields while minimizing waste.Despite its many advantages, there are also challenges associated with the airborne remote sensing technique. The cost of acquiring and operating the necessary equipment can be prohibitive for some organizations, particularly smaller research groups or conservation efforts. Additionally, the interpretation of the data collected requires specialized knowledge and skills, which may not be readily available in all fields.In conclusion, the airborne remote sensing technique represents a powerful approach to environmental monitoring and resource management. Its ability to gather extensive data quickly and accurately makes it an essential tool for scientists, policymakers, and land managers.
